From owner-freebsd-usb@FreeBSD.ORG Sun May 19 09:09:47 2013 Return-Path: Delivered-To: freebsd-usb@freebsd.org Received: from mx1.freebsd.org (mx1.freebsd.org [IPv6:2001:1900:2254:206a::19:1]) by hub.freebsd.org (Postfix) with ESMTP id 16F236D8; Sun, 19 May 2013 09:09:47 +0000 (UTC) (envelope-from guru@unixarea.de) Received: from ms16-1.1blu.de (ms16-1.1blu.de [89.202.0.34]) by mx1.freebsd.org (Postfix) with ESMTP id 95210F0A; Sun, 19 May 2013 09:09:46 +0000 (UTC) Received: from [93.104.7.98] (helo=localhost.my.domain) by ms16-1.1blu.de with esmtpsa (TLS-1.0:DHE_RSA_AES_256_CBC_SHA1:32) (Exim 4.69) (envelope-from ) id 1Udzce-0003xa-1B; Sun, 19 May 2013 11:09:44 +0200 Received: from localhost.my.domain (localhost [127.0.0.1]) by localhost.my.domain (8.14.7/8.14.3) with ESMTP id r4JB9kLC006331; Sun, 19 May 2013 11:09:46 GMT (envelope-from guru@unixarea.de) Received: (from guru@localhost) by localhost.my.domain (8.14.7/8.14.3/Submit) id r4JB9jaE006330; Sun, 19 May 2013 11:09:45 GMT (envelope-from guru@unixarea.de) X-Authentication-Warning: localhost.my.domain: guru set sender to guru@unixarea.de using -f Date: Sun, 19 May 2013 11:09:44 +0000 From: Matthias Apitz To: Hans Petter Selasky Subject: Re: revision higher than 250508 breaks webcam support Message-ID: <20130519110944.GA6282@La-Habana> References: MIME-Version: 1.0 Content-Type: multipart/mixed; boundary="5mCyUwZo2JvN/JJP" Content-Disposition: inline Content-Transfer-Encoding: 8bit In-Reply-To: X-Operating-System: FreeBSD 9.0-CURRENT r214444 (i386) User-Agent: Mutt/1.5.21 (2010-09-15) X-Con-Id: 51246 X-Con-U: 0-guru X-Originating-IP: 93.104.7.98 Cc: =?utf-8?B?Sm/FvmU=?= Zobec , Adrian Chadd , "freebsd-usb@freebsd.org" X-BeenThere: freebsd-usb@freebsd.org X-Mailman-Version: 2.1.14 Precedence: list Reply-To: Matthias Apitz List-Id: FreeBSD support for USB List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Sun, 19 May 2013 09:09:47 -0000 --5mCyUwZo2JvN/JJP Content-Type: text/plain; charset=iso-8859-1 Content-Disposition: inline Content-Transfer-Encoding: 8bit El día Saturday, May 18, 2013 a las 12:48:12AM +0200, Hans Petter Selasky escribió: > Hi, > >   > Can you try the attached patch. Seems like your audio device has some additional USB audio requirements. > >   > --HPS > Hello Hans, I have spammed work/webcamd-3.9.0.5/webcamd.c a bit with additional printf(3C) statements... when I do the probing of the cam in Skype the attached output of ioctls are printed out but no picture appears in the small Skype probing window area; even more when I cycle with Ctrl-TAB through the desktop areas and come back to the one containing Skype, in the probing window is text from some other desktop visible, just as X area would not get updated there... Any ideas what could be wrong or where to look deeper? Thanks matthias -- Matthias Apitz | /"\ ASCII Ribbon Campaign: www.asciiribbon.org E-mail: guru@unixarea.de | \ / - No HTML/RTF in E-mail WWW: http://www.unixarea.de/ | X - No proprietary attachments phone: +49-170-4527211 | / \ - Respect for open standards --5mCyUwZo2JvN/JJP Content-Type: text/plain; charset=us-ascii Content-Disposition: attachment; filename=stdout Linux video capture interface: v2.00 lirc_dev: IR Remote Control driver registered, major 14 IR NEC protocol handler initialized IR RC5(x) protocol handler initialized IR RC6 protocol handler initialized IR JVC protocol handler initialized IR Sony protocol handler initialized IR RC5 (streamzap) protocol handler initialized IR SANYO protocol handler initialized IR LIRC bridge handler initialized b2c2-flexcop: B2C2 FlexcopII/II(b)/III digital TV receiver chip loaded successfully uvcvideo: Unable to create debugfs directory USB Video Class driver (1.1.1) cpia2: V4L-Driver for Vision CPiA2 based cameras v3.0.1 au0828 driver loaded pvrusb2: V4L in-tree version:Hauppauge WinTV-PVR-USB2 MPEG2 Encoder/Tuner pvrusb2: Debug mask is 31 (0x1f) USBVision USB Video Device Driver for Linux : 0.9.11 Em28xx: Initialized (Em28xx dvb Extension) extension Attached to ugen4.2[0] uvcvideo: Found UVC 1.00 device WebCam (0c45:62c0) Creating /dev/video0 DEBUG: v4b_open() DEBUG: linux_ioctl() cmd: 40685600 returns: 00000000 DEBUG: linux_ioctl() cmd: 40685600 returns: 00000000 DEBUG: linux_ioctl() cmd: c0cc5604 returns: 00000000 DEBUG: linux_ioctl() cmd: c0405602 returns: 00000000 DEBUG: linux_ioctl() cmd: c0405602 returns: ffffffea DEBUG: linux_ioctl() cmd: 40685600 returns: 00000000 DEBUG: linux_ioctl() cmd: 40045626 returns: 00000000 DEBUG: linux_ioctl() cmd: c04c561a returns: 00000000 DEBUG: linux_ioctl() cmd: c0445624 returns: 00000000 DEBUG: linux_ioctl() cmd: 40685600 returns: 00000000 DEBUG: linux_ioctl() cmd: c0cc5605 returns: 00000000 DEBUG: linux_ioctl() cmd: c0cc5640 returns: 00000000 DEBUG: linux_ioctl() cmd: c0cc5605 returns: 00000000 DEBUG: linux_ioctl() cmd: c0cc5640 returns: 00000000 DEBUG: linux_ioctl() cmd: c0cc5605 returns: 00000000 DEBUG: linux_ioctl() cmd: c0cc5605 returns: 00000000 DEBUG: linux_ioctl() cmd: c0cc5605 returns: 00000000 DEBUG: linux_ioctl() cmd: c0cc5605 returns: 00000000 DEBUG: linux_ioctl() cmd: c0cc5605 returns: 00000000 DEBUG: linux_ioctl() cmd: c0cc5605 returns: 00000000 DEBUG: linux_ioctl() cmd: c0cc5605 returns: 00000000 DEBUG: linux_ioctl() cmd: c0cc5605 returns: 00000000 DEBUG: linux_ioctl() cmd: c0cc5640 returns: 00000000 DEBUG: linux_ioctl() cmd: c0cc5605 returns: 00000000 DEBUG: linux_ioctl() cmd: c0cc5615 returns: 00000000 DEBUG: linux_ioctl() cmd: c0cc5616 returns: 00000000 DEBUG: linux_ioctl() cmd: c0145608 returns: 00000000 DEBUG: linux_ioctl() cmd: c0445609 returns: 00000000 DEBUG: linux_ioctl() cmd: c0445609 returns: 00000000 DEBUG: linux_ioctl() cmd: c0445609 returns: 00000000 DEBUG: linux_ioctl() cmd: c0445609 returns: 00000000 DEBUG: v4b_close() DEBUG: v4b_open() DEBUG: linux_ioctl() cmd: 40685600 returns: 00000000 DEBUG: linux_ioctl() cmd: 40685600 returns: 00000000 DEBUG: linux_ioctl() cmd: c0cc5604 returns: 00000000 DEBUG: linux_ioctl() cmd: c0405602 returns: 00000000 DEBUG: linux_ioctl() cmd: c0405602 returns: ffffffea DEBUG: linux_ioctl() cmd: 40685600 returns: 00000000 DEBUG: linux_ioctl() cmd: 40045626 returns: 00000000 DEBUG: linux_ioctl() cmd: c04c561a returns: 00000000 DEBUG: linux_ioctl() cmd: c0445624 returns: 00000000 DEBUG: linux_ioctl() cmd: 40685600 returns: 00000000 DEBUG: linux_ioctl() cmd: c0cc5605 returns: 00000000 DEBUG: linux_ioctl() cmd: c0cc5640 returns: 00000000 DEBUG: linux_ioctl() cmd: c0cc5605 returns: 00000000 DEBUG: linux_ioctl() cmd: c0cc5640 returns: 00000000 DEBUG: linux_ioctl() cmd: c0cc5605 returns: 00000000 DEBUG: linux_ioctl() cmd: c0cc5605 returns: 00000000 DEBUG: linux_ioctl() cmd: c0cc5605 returns: 00000000 DEBUG: linux_ioctl() cmd: c0cc5605 returns: 00000000 DEBUG: linux_ioctl() cmd: c0cc5605 returns: 00000000 DEBUG: linux_ioctl() cmd: c0cc5605 returns: 00000000 DEBUG: linux_ioctl() cmd: c0cc5605 returns: 00000000 DEBUG: linux_ioctl() cmd: c0cc5605 returns: 00000000 DEBUG: linux_ioctl() cmd: c0cc5640 returns: 00000000 DEBUG: linux_ioctl() cmd: c0cc5605 returns: 00000000 DEBUG: linux_ioctl() cmd: c0cc5615 returns: 00000000 DEBUG: linux_ioctl() cmd: c0cc5616 returns: 00000000 DEBUG: linux_ioctl() cmd: c0145608 returns: 00000000 DEBUG: linux_ioctl() cmd: c0445609 returns: 00000000 DEBUG: linux_ioctl() cmd: c0445609 returns: 00000000 DEBUG: linux_ioctl() cmd: c0445609 returns: 00000000 DEBUG: linux_ioctl() cmd: c0445609 returns: 00000000 DEBUG: linux_ioctl() cmd: c044560f returns: 00000000 DEBUG: linux_ioctl() cmd: c044560f returns: 00000000 DEBUG: linux_ioctl() cmd: c044560f returns: 00000000 DEBUG: linux_ioctl() cmd: c044560f returns: 00000000 DEBUG: linux_ioctl() cmd: 80045612 returns: 00000000 DEBUG: v4b_poll() DEBUG: v4b_poll() DEBUG: v4b_poll() DEBUG: v4b_poll() DEBUG: v4b_poll() DEBUG: v4b_poll() DEBUG: linux_ioctl() cmd: c0445611 returns: 00000000 DEBUG: linux_ioctl() cmd: c044560f returns: 00000000 DEBUG: v4b_poll() DEBUG: v4b_poll() DEBUG: linux_ioctl() cmd: c0445611 returns: 00000000 DEBUG: linux_ioctl() cmd: c044560f returns: 00000000 DEBUG: v4b_poll() DEBUG: v4b_poll() DEBUG: linux_ioctl() cmd: c0445611 returns: 00000000 DEBUG: linux_ioctl() cmd: c044560f returns: 00000000 DEBUG: v4b_poll() DEBUG: v4b_poll() DEBUG: linux_ioctl() cmd: c0445611 returns: 00000000 DEBUG: linux_ioctl() cmd: c044560f returns: 00000000 DEBUG: v4b_poll() DEBUG: v4b_poll() DEBUG: linux_ioctl() cmd: c0445611 returns: 00000000 DEBUG: linux_ioctl() cmd: c044560f returns: 00000000 DEBUG: v4b_poll() DEBUG: v4b_poll() DEBUG: linux_ioctl() cmd: c0445611 returns: 00000000 DEBUG: linux_ioctl() cmd: c044560f returns: 00000000 DEBUG: v4b_poll() DEBUG: v4b_poll() DEBUG: linux_ioctl() cmd: c0445611 returns: 00000000 DEBUG: linux_ioctl() cmd: c044560f returns: 00000000 DEBUG: v4b_poll() DEBUG: v4b_poll() DEBUG: linux_ioctl() cmd: c0445611 returns: 00000000 DEBUG: linux_ioctl() cmd: c044560f returns: 00000000 DEBUG: v4b_poll() DEBUG: v4b_poll() DEBUG: v4b_poll() DEBUG: v4b_poll() DEBUG: linux_ioctl() cmd: c0445611 returns: 00000000 DEBUG: linux_ioctl() cmd: c044560f returns: 00000000 DEBUG: v4b_poll() DEBUG: v4b_poll() DEBUG: linux_ioctl() cmd: c0445611 returns: 00000000 DEBUG: linux_ioctl() cmd: c044560f returns: 00000000 DEBUG: linux_ioctl() cmd: 80045613 returns: 00000000 DEBUG: v4b_close() --5mCyUwZo2JvN/JJP--